Spoilers for 'The Outpost' Season 3 Episode 4 titled 'The Key to Paradise'

In the latest episode of 'The Outpost' Season 3, Yavalla (Jaye Griffiths) has threatened to take over the Outpost. As predicted by several fans, her kinj takes over the mind of whoever it is passed on to. It forms a hive as soon enough anyone can pass on that kinj to the other person. This is the key to paradise that she so promised to the people here.

As it turns out, only those with a kinj can keep away from Yavalla's, which leaves Talon (Jessica Green) and Zed (Reece Ritchie). And the remaining others happen to be the only ones with common sense. As Gwynn (Imogen Waterhouse) passes this kinj to another, she enlarges the hive, bringing more people under Yavalla's control. Rightly so, considering how the next episode is titled 'Under Yavalla's Control'. Most of the episode focused on this power grab move. The makers indulged fans of the latest couple of the show Janzo (Anand Desai-Barochia) and Wren (Izuka Hoyle) as they "experiment" unions between Blackbloods and humans for "science reasons".

Back at Aegisford, Tobin (Aaron Fontaine) is faced with a difficult choice. He is left with no money and men since the war with the Prime Order. Where is the army that he was supposed to take back home? When an old flame shows up with the required men and a proposal, Tobin is forced to consider. Eventually, he also gives in but might later come to realise that it was all an attempt in vain. Gwynn and Tobin should have realised that the Blackbloods are above a human army - especially now with Yavalla's kinj.

'The Outpost' Episode 3 was a bit of a drag as it showed Yavalla take over each character's presence. Garett Spears (Jake Stormoen) is back but has everyone at the Gallwood Outpost looking for him. 'The Key to Paradise' reveals Yavalla's true intentions of bringing peace to the two factions. With her kinj, Blackbloods and humans might live in unity, but it is going to come at a heavy price. Hopefully, by next episode or so, they can wind up with the Yavalla obstacle because it fails to generate intrigue.
